Building Your Optimal All Firing Character Team
Team building is at the core of All Firing's combat system. With a three-character switching system, you can swap between teammates in real-time, combining attacks to create powerful combos. The goal is to balance elemental coverage with complementary combat roles to tackle any challenge.
Early in the game, it's better to focus your resources on a main team of three strong characters. Spreading resources too thin can hinder your progression, as upgrade materials can run out quickly.

Character Progression and Enhancement
To maximize your All Firing character potential, you'll need to invest in their growth through various systems. This includes leveling, upgrading talents, equipping Familiars, and utilizing Relics and Engravings.
Leveling Up Characters
Gain experience through combat and story progression. Use experience materials to quickly boost character levels, unlocking higher stats and access to new talents.
Talent Tree Upgrades
Each character has a unique talent tree. Spend materials (obtainable from the Sanctum) to upgrade abilities, enhancing their combat effectiveness and unlocking new skills.
Equipping Familiars
Familiars act as pets, assisting in battles. Crucially, pair Familiars with characters of the same elemental type to maximize damage and gain elemental advantage. For example, an Ice Familiar with an Ice character.
Relics (Gear) Acquisition
Relics are your character's gear, providing stats and set bonuses. Always aim for Relic sets that match your character's element to activate powerful bonuses, such as increased Wind damage for a Wind character.
Engravings (Awakening)
When you obtain duplicate characters from the gacha system, you can use them for Engravings. These provide significant bonuses, such as automatic strength resonance stacks upon entering battle, further enhancing character power.

Optimizing Combat with Character Switching
The side-scrolling action combat in All Firing thrives on seamless character switching. Mastering this mechanic is crucial for dealing maximum damage, avoiding attacks, and creating spectacular combos.
The combat system emphasizes switching characters in and out. When characters glow in the right corner, it's an indicator to chain them for powerful combo attacks, similar to other action RPGs that feature character swapping for extra damage.

Frequently Asked Questions About All Firing Characters
Q: How do I get new All Firing characters?
New characters are primarily obtained through the gacha system (summons) in the game. You can use Stardust or Infinite Stardust to pull for new companions, with higher rarity characters offering more power.
Q: What is the best way to upgrade my characters quickly?
Focusing resources on your main three characters, completing daily missions and story chapters, and grinding dungeons for materials are the most efficient ways to upgrade characters quickly. Don't forget to match Familiars and Relics to their elements!
